.csc-header {
  padding-left:5px;
  padding-top:10px;
  float:left;
  width:98%;
  }
.csc-header h1 {
  font-family:"Trebuchet MS",Trebuchet,Verdana;
  font-size:2em;
  font-size-adjust:none;
  font-style:normal;
  font-variant:normal;
  font-weight:100;
  line-height:normal;
  margin:0px;
  color:#888888;
  }
.bodytext {
  padding-left:5px;
  }
#content-main-sub h2 {
  color:#888888;
  font-family:"Trebuchet MS",Trebuchet,Verdana;
  font-size:16px;
  font-size-adjust:none;
  font-style:normal;
  font-variant:normal;
  font-weight:100;
  line-height:normal;
  margin:0;
  padding-left:5px;
  padding-top:20px;
  }
/* --------------------------------- */
#banner-left {
  float:left;
  width:100%;
  }
#banner-top-nav1 {
  float:left;
  width:52%;
  }
#banner-top-login {
  float:left;
  width:18%;
  color:white;
  }
/* --------------------------------- */
#nimenu {
  list-style-type:none;
  }
#nimenu .pageitem a {
  color:white;
  }
#nimenu .pageitem a,
#nimenu .pageitemact a {
  display:block;
  font-size:12px;
  padding:8px;
  text-decoration:none;
  height: 58px;
  }
#nimenu .pageitemact a {
  color:#333333;
  }
/* #nimenu .pageitemact a {
  color:#FFFFFF;
  }*/
#nimenu .pageitem a:hover {
  background-color:#14468C;
  }
#nimenu li {
  display:inline;
  }
#header .pageitem,
#header .pageitemact {
  float:left;
  }
#nimenu ul {
  margin:0px;
  padding:0px;
  }
.pageitemact {
  background-color:#FFC907;
  color:black;
  }
/* --------------------------------- Footer */
#footer {
  color:white;
  }